Transaction 2015c8577d56c87e68daef2c25555cc49bb4dbe0c1d264f94ca4955b40201af6
1 Input
1 Output
-
2015c8577d56c87e68daef2c25555cc49bb4dbe0c1d264f94ca4955b40201af6:0
- value
- 126106
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 132934945e10e35d08977fcb12a946fdca26a8ef OP_EQUAL
- address
- 33SL8BvY63imvZFn8XRHHjaywj28py5vYn